About Ilza Monteiro
Ilza Monteiro is a scholar working on Obstetrics and Gynecology, Reproductive Medicine,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health and General Health Professions, having authored 64 papers that have together received 1.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Reproductive Health and Contraception (46 papers), Maternal and Perinatal Health Interventions (13 papers), Endometriosis Research and Treatment (12 papers), Ectopic Pregnancy Diagnosis and Management (11 papers), Global Maternal and Child Health (11 papers), Maternal and fetal healthcare (10 papers), Male Reproductive Health Studies (9 papers) and Uterine Myomas and Treatments (9 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Obstetrics and Gynecology (519 citations), Reproductive Medicine (394 citations),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(803 citations),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health (392 citations) and Microbiology (46 citations). Ilza Monteiro has collaborated with scholars based in Brazil, United States and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include Luís Bahamondes, M. Valeria Bahamondes, Arlete Fernandes, Carlos Alberto Petta, Jeffrey T. Jensen, François Bissonnette, Eeva Lukkari‐Lax, Andrew M. Kaunitz, Juan Dı́az and Ximena Espejo‐Arce. Their work appears in journals such as Contraception, The European Journal of Contraception & Reproductive Health Care, International Journal of Gynecology & Obstetrics, Human Reproduction and Expert Opinion on Pharmacotherapy.
